NEW YORK, USA – The new LG Escape will soon be available at $50 through AT&T, and the yet-to-be-announced LG Optimus G will bring a 13 megapixel camera .
Powered by Android 4.0 ICS, the LG Escape features a 1.2GHz dual-core processor and 4GB of onboard memory expandable to 32GB with microSD. The 4.3″ qHD IPS touchscreen is made of durable Gorilla glass. The Escape also includes a 5MP camera with 1080p HD recording, Bluetooth, NFC, Google Integration and a powerful 2150mAh battery.
Verizon has started selling the LG Intuition, better known as the Optimus Vu, for $199 with a two-year contract. It features a dual-core 1.5GHz processor, 1GB of RAM and 32GB of storage. In addition to the 5″ IPS LCD, 8MP rear camera and 1.3MP front camera, it supports USB 2.0, Wi-Fi, Bluetooth 3.0 and HDMI. NFC radio and LG’s Tag+ stickers are other cool features of the Intuition.
As suggested previously, US Cellular is now selling the LG Splendor. However, its specifications are somewhat low-grade, including a single-core 1GHz CPU, 2GB of storage, a 4.3″ WVGA display and a 5MP camera.
Meanwhile, a promo video of LG Optimus G’s 13MP camera has been released. The high-resolution camera module contains a smaller 1/3″ sensor with 1.1-micron pixels. According to the video, an 8MP version of the sensor will also be available.
